The Kannada film Blink, directed by Srinidhi Bengaluru, has a truly unique storyline, unlike anything I’ve seen before in Indian cinema, blending elements of time travel and Greek mythology. It also pays tribute to folk artists and theater performers as well. The film centers around Apoorva, who is insecure about his future. The plot shows us his past life, where after meeting a mysterious man and experimenting with time travel, Apoorva discovers the shocking truth about his father, which changes everything he thought he knew. Even though we know that Blink is Srinidhi Bengaluru’s debut project, how he has blended past and present with mystery, drama, and sci-fi elements is truly something else. Actress Apoorva Arora, who is awaiting the release of her upcoming streaming show ‘Family Aaj Kal’, has shared her experience of working with the late actor Nitesh Pandey. She said that the two always shared a cordial relationship.
The actress said that he was more than a co-actor, and called him a father figure both on and off-screen as he treated her like a daughter.
Talking about her bond with Nitesh, Apoorva said: “The series beautifully portrays a father-daughter bond, a theme close to my heart as I share a similar bond with my father in real life. Working with Nitesh was a blessing; he was more than just a co-star but a father figure both on and off-screen. Nitesh was amazing on set! Even though he had so much experience, he was always friendly and supportive.”

Riteish Deshmukh’s Mumbai Heroes register a nerve-racking one-run win over Bhojpuri Dabanggs at the Celebrity Cricket League (Ccl) in Hyderabad on Sunday. The defeat marked the end of the Dabbanggs’ playoff aspirations, after three consecutive losses in the T10-format tournament.
In the first innings, actors Sohail Khan and Saqib Saleem opened for Mumbai Heroes. After four overs, Sohail Khan retired hurt. And Mumbai lost their second wicket in Apoorva Lakhia. The bowling attack of the Bhojpuri Dabanggs restricted Mumbai to 95-5.
Anshuman Rajput, and Aditya Ojha opened for the Dabbanggs and they faced the pace of Riteish Deshmukh. Aditya fell in the second over, but Anshuman made up with a spirited 51-run knock, helping the Dabbanggs put up 89-3. The Mumbai Heroes were leading by six runs.
Directors Apoorva Lakhia and Samir Kochar opened for the Heroes in the second innings, thanks to Sohail sustaining an injury.

NewsMohan played the role of Appu's (Kamal Haasan) best friend in Apoorva Sagodharargal. After that, he also played smaller roles in Arya’s Naan Kadavul and Adhisaya Manithargal. IANSTamil actor Mohan, known for his supporting comedic roles, was reportedly found dead on a street in Madurai’s Thiruparankundram. The 60-year-old actor was best known for his comedic role in Kamal Haasan’s Apoorva Sagodharargal (1989). According to reports, the actor was living in impoverished conditions after his wife passed away ten years ago. The Times of India reported that the deceased actor had resorted to begging as he could not make a living in cinema. Mohan played the role of Appu's (Kamal Haasan) best friend in Apoorva Sagodharargal. After that, he also played smaller roles in Arya’s Naan Kadavul and Adhisaya Manithargal. Despite playing small roles, Mohan did not see a future in cinema so he moved to Thiruparankundram.

Exclusive: Emmy award-winning Indian producer Apoorva Bakshi (Delhi Crime) has boarded The Glassworker, Pakistan’s first ever Hayao Miyazaki-style animated feature, as an executive producer.
Bakshi, who is producing through her Awedacious Originals banner, joins a growing team of supporters of the ground-breaking 2D hand-drawn project, directed by Pakistan’s Usman Riaz and produced through his Karachi-based Mano Animation Studios.
Spanish animation producer Manuel Cristobal is also on board the project, while Paris-based sales agency Charades picked up international rights after it was presented as a work-in-progress at Annecy International Animation Film Festival last year. The film is currently in post-production and scheduled for delivery in August.
Set in a location loosely inspired by Pakistan, the film revolves around a father and son who run the finest glass workshop in the country but find their lives upended by an approaching war in which they want no part.

Director Apoorva Lakhia is all set to bring forth a brave story of the Indian Army for the silver screen. The director has acquired the rights of a chapter from the book titled ‘India’s Most Fearless – 3’ to be adapted into a movie. The story is based on the events that took place between the Indian and Chinese troops at the Galwan region on the 14th of June 2020 when 200 Indian Soldiers bravely defended their territory against a well-trained force of 1200 Chinese Liberation Army soldiers.
The book is written by seasoned journalists Shiv Aroor, Senior Executive Editor at India today TV and Rahul Singh, Senior Editor at the Hindustan Times, both the authors are known for their military affairs journalism.
The story and screenplay will be adapted for the film by Suresh Nair in association with Chintan Gandhi and Chintan Shah who will also pen the dialogues.
